When installing a Flatpak application that depends on some runtimes and
they depend on some additional runtime extensions using GNOME Software
on Ubuntu 18.04, the runtime extensions are not installed. They are
installed if you run "flatpak update" from Terminal after the
installation. This issue should be already fixed in GNOME Software
upstream so I believe that this is a downstream Ubuntu issue. Please,
fix this.

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Use the latest, fully updated Ubuntu 18.04 image.
2. Install "flatpak" and "gnome-software-plugin-flatpak" packages.
3. Restart the system.
4. Download and add the Flathub repo file: 
https://dl.flathub.org/repo/flathub.flatpakrepo
5. Search and install the "GNOME Web" Flatpak package using GNOME Software.
6. Run the installed "Web" application.

Actual results:
GNOME Web is started with the default (Adwaita) theme (and without the correct 
locale if you use non-English system).

Expected results:
GNOME Web is started with the correct (Ubuntu) theme (and with the correct 
locale if you use non-English system).
